Tax Administrative Assistant
We are looking for a dedicated and efficient Tax Administrative Assistant to join our team in Manhattan Beach, California. In this Contract to permanent position, you will play a crucial role in supporting the tax department by managing documentation, organizing records, and ensuring compliance with deadlines. This opportunity is ideal for someone who thrives in a fast-paced environment and has exceptional organizational and communication skills.<br><br>Responsibilities:<br>• Assist tax professionals in preparing, filing, and organizing tax documents at federal, state, and local levels.<br>• Maintain and update client records to ensure accuracy and compliance with regulations.<br>• Review financial documents, invoices, and supporting materials for tax purposes.<br>• Perform data entry tasks related to client accounts, tax forms, and financial records.<br>• Coordinate schedules, appointments, and submission deadlines for the tax team.<br>• Prepare and format correspondence, reports, and presentations as required.<br>• Support audit processes by gathering documentation and responding to inquiries from clients or regulatory agencies.<br>• Uphold confidentiality and protect sensitive financial and client information.
• Previous experience in an administrative role, ideally within accounting, tax, or financial services.<br>•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ite, including Excel, Word, and Outlook; familiarity with accounting software is a plus.<br>• Excellent organizational abilities and attention to detail.<br>• Strong verbal and written communication skills.<br>• Capability to multitask and prioritize assignments effectively in a fast-paced setting.<br>• Detail-oriented approach and dedication to delivering exceptional client service.<br>• Understanding of tax-related terminology, forms, and processes is preferred but not mandatory.
